Leon worships strength in every sense of the word, which is why he insists on paying close attention to his physique as well as spending hours each day trying to improve his control over his power. He is always dieting in one shape or form, as his followers will be aware, and can often be found reading books on the subject of self-improvement. He treats himself as a project not yet finished, and pushes himself to the limits of what a human being can handle, in order to become stronger.
From an outsider's, objective, perspective, Leon is a lot like your average cult leader. Charming, a good conversational partner, a good listener, a man who easily gains the trust of people around him and seems to deliver on his promises as long as they serve his cause in the long run. He has an infinite love for his followers and seems almost self-sacrificial in his protection of them, even though most of them are fully able to take care of themselves.
He has a mild temper, almost pedagogic in his treatment of other people, and can be perceived as a rather charming, outgoing man. However, it's clear that he has some issues brewing beneath it all, and when the right buttons are pushed, he can become violent. He is also frightfully determined in the pursuit of his goal and has been known to snap at people around him if things are moving too slowly for his liking.

The discovery of his power at a young age was, all in all, not an overly dramatic affair. It was more of a slow burn kind of deal, where his inability to take care of houseplants seemed to spin out of control. He didn't overthink it until the garden itself seemed unable to withstand his presence, despite his mother's best efforts. Leon went away for a week to a friend's house and when he came back the garden seemed a lot better. Given his living situation it wasn't long before he was accused of being the devil. Surprisingly, his calm and otherwise level-headed family turned on him, and called one of the more... traditional priests.
The exorcisms came first. Obviously not horrible in themselves, as there was no demon to remove and no real pain in having some holy water splashed in your face by a screaming priest, but to a young man the scene was rather traumatic. Repetition made it worse. Then there were the looks, of course, the way they spoke to him, and spoke about him, when they thought he wasn't listening. It was maddening. Leaving wasn't a hard choice. Finding the Safe Haven was worse. It's not the kind of thing you can just ask for, and so he found it rather by chance, shortly after its creation.
